Memories



Memories in a basket
Struck though with pain
Better left in a casket
Than washed down the drain
Floating through the air
Drifting in the sea
Tugging at your hair
Now you can finally breathe

POET'S NOTES ABOUT THE POEM
I dedicate this poem to my past. May I never go back!
